Все!!! Я сам додумал....
Вот так надо было написать:
function on_panel() {
typestr="" // Все дело в том, что строка эта после отработки функции бла не пуста.
on_id = event.srcElement
num_id = on_id.id;
lem=document.getElementById("u_"+num_id);
if(lem.style.visibility=="hidden") {
coord=window.event;
lem.style.top=coord.clientY+20;
lem.style.left=coord.clientX+20;
lem.style.visibility="visible";
xinterval = setInterval("wrtext()", 50)
}
else {
lem.style.visibility="hidden";
i=0
}
}